解题思路:
注意事项:
参考代码:
#include <stdio.h>
int main()
{
int n;
int i,j;
int m,sum;
int a[50]={0};
scanf("%d",&n);
for(i=2;i<=n;i++)
{
m=0;
sum=0;
for(j=1;j<i;j++)
if(i%j==0)
sum+=j;
if(i==sum)
{
for(j=1;j<i;j++)
if(i%j==0) a[m++]=j;
printf("%d its factors are ",i);
for(m=0;a[m]!=0;m++)
printf("%d ",a[m]);
printf("\n");
}
}
return 0;
}
0.0分
0 人评分
C语言训练-舍罕王的失算 (C++代码)(都给答案了还算什么)浏览:972 |
C语言程序设计教程(第三版)课后习题1.5 (C语言代码)浏览:548 |
C语言程序设计教程(第三版)课后习题1.5 (C语言代码)浏览:577 |
C语言训练-大、小写问题 (C语言代码)浏览:611 |
WU-蓝桥杯算法提高VIP-勾股数 (C++代码)浏览:1592 |
【蟠桃记】 (C语言代码)浏览:664 |
简单的a+b (C语言代码)浏览:807 |
【蟠桃记】 (C语言代码)浏览:1021 |
C语言训练-数字母 (C语言代码)浏览:600 |
【偶数求和】 (C语言代码)浏览:430 |